Output 45c7889436281999114266e53071727345256999db55d022bca7c3cb64abe216:3

value
172217133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78b54c2e11a3c26aa8dea04e2e1f145761201b9c OP_EQUAL
address
MJuQWE5qGc7W6f2wq6r1bzmqsJMpAtw2Wc
transaction
45c7889436281999114266e53071727345256999db55d022bca7c3cb64abe216
spent
true